Principal Protected Structures Principal Protectect Structures are any structured notes or strucutred certificates of deposit that offer 100% Principal Protection when held to maturity. These structures typically forego a coupon in exchange for participation in an underlying asset. In its simplest form, a Principal Protectect Structure can be thought of as a zero coupon CD or bond combined with a derivative component, usually represented in the form of options.

Accelerated Return Notes Accelerated Return Notes, or ARNs, are senior unsecured debt securities issued by Merrill Lynch & Co., Inc. (ML&Co.) that offer investors the opportunity to earn three times the upside appreciation potential of the underlying security, index or basket of securities, up to a specific cap, while only risking one for one on the downside.

Reverse Convertible Notes Reverse Convertible Notes (RCNs) are short-term, coupon-bearing notes designed to provide enhanced yield while participating in certain equity-like risks. Available in various structures and risk-return profiles, RCNs can act as an important tool when structuring diversified portfolios.
